The Department of Veterans Affairs need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to provide eye laser and cryostat service and support.
Key Details
- What exactly do they need? The Department of Veterans Affairs needs a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business to provide eye laser and cryostat service and support.
- What's the contract structure and timeline? The contract is a 5-year Service Agreement with a base year and 4 option years.
- How will they pick the winner? The evaluation will be based on the lowest price technically acceptable.
- When and how do you bid? Bids must be submitted through the Federal Business Opportunities website by July 31, 2026.
